On the end of the (very) long 1960s.
[For the full episode, subscribe at patreon.com/bungacast]
Contributing Editor Lee Jones joins Alex and George to talk through the themes and stories of the month, including MAGA's war on universities, right-populists in power, and culture war. Plus we deal with your questions and comments on: lawfare, video games, and the 'new class'.
